Transaction 164665ba21c1f343f54e778628153c4a6401e595c07d35aa4d466cc62af56241

1 Input
1 Outputs
  • 164665ba21c1f343f54e778628153c4a6401e595c07d35aa4d466cc62af56241:0
  • value  12377
    address  33zLg2KzPfvqPpAtRcVF342A5V3d4QKknV